Finished my build of the IHYSC Worker suit. This limited run resin kit from 2009 was based on the sketch by Kow. Very little is know about it but I infer it was the augmented construction suit that lead to the AFS Mk1.
The kit had a low parts count and went together quickly though I should have spent more time pinning the joints as arms and legs kept popping off from manhandling. I added a few wires and tubes and omitted some of the leg compression springs to expedite the build. The head was replaced with the grinning idiot from BrickWorks and the hands are from Pink Tank.
The suit is airbrushed with Tamiya acrylics using the hairspray technique. Figure head is painted with Vallejo. I rushed at the end to get ready for a local show the next day so the base is recycled from an older build. I may go back and visit this on a proper display.
